How to Get a Honda Civic Key Replacement

There are a variety of ways to acquire a Honda Civic replacement key or an extra key with a fob that matches. You can make use of your vehicle's VIN (Vehicle identification Number) to acquire an additional key. If you are looking for a less expensive option, you can find numerous companies that can create your new keys using your original key.

Cost of a replacement Honda civic key, without the original

Finding a replacement Honda Civic key isn't always simple. It can be costly, especially if you need to take your vehicle towards the dealer. However, there are ways to make it less expensive and more convenient to get a replacement.

A replacement Honda key is more than just a key. The VIN (key code) is also important. It assists the dealership in figuring out what you own. The Honda VIN is located on the left hand side of the dashboard next to the mirror.

The key can be bought at the dealer, or you can buy it on the internet. The dealership can cut the key, but you can also have the same key made by a local locksmith. The transponder key is equipped with the microchip. This type of key is the most technologically advanced, but it is costly to replace.

In newer models there are keyless entry systems. They're also complex but offer an increased level of security. Some models don't require professional programming. When you are within range of the key, the key will turn on your vehicle. The battery's life is dependent on how you use it, as well as the weather.

An emergency key can be included with the key. This key can be used to open the trunk in case the battery is dead. It is designed to work on all doors.

You can also purchase a replacement Honda key battery. There are a variety of stores that sell them, and they're relatively cheap. The average price is $5. The battery can also be ordered online. There are many options for getting a new Honda civic key

It isn't easy to find an alternative Honda Civic Key. This is due to the fact that the keys are transponder keys that are equipped with a microchip. Some models might require professional programming. You might also need to replace the battery of your key.

The first step in replacing the Honda Civic key is to identify the year of your vehicle. This will allow you to figure whether you'll need to have it replaced by a dealer. If your car is older than 10 yearsold, you might also require replacing your key with a transponder. These keys are more expensive than regular keys. You may also have to pay to get the key to the dealership.

Once you have identified the year of your car You can then go online and purchase a new key. You'll need to provide your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and photo identification. You may also be required to provide your vehicle's registration number and proof of ownership.

An automotive locksmith can program your replacement key. They can make you your replacement key using your VIN and also match the keys to your car. They can do this for anywhere between $200 and $250. However, they might have cut the key for you.

If your key is stuck in the ignition, it's likely that it's a steering wheel lock. If it is an a locking for a steering lock you can either fix the lock or have the key replaced by locksmiths. A locksmith can be a huge help when you need to swiftly access your vehicle.

You may also want to check the battery on your Honda Civic key. The year of your car will determine the kind of battery you will need. The batteries are typically flat round 3-volt batteries. They are available in various stores.

Signs of a dying key fob


It can be frustrating when your Honda Civic key fob malfunction. A dead battery is the main reason for this issue. g28carkeys.co.uk is not as difficult as you think to replace a key fob's battery.

It is recommended to always consult the manual of your vehicle for specific information regarding the battery for your key fob. For assistance, it's best to speak with an ASE certified mechanic.

If your Civic key fob battery has been lying on a shelf for some time, you might need a replacement. If you're not sure what type of battery you need it is recommended to contact Honda for assistance. It is important to get an appropriate battery. The Civic's battery is distinct from the model it comes with.

Also, you should ensure that the battery contacts are free of dirt. If they are dirty, corrosion can reduce the battery's life span. It is recommended to find a replacement battery that matches the voltage and size of the one you have.

If you're still experiencing issues with your key fob, there could be more serious problems with the system. There may be an issue with the antenna or a damaged circuit board, or an inoperative start button. Weather conditions or other objects can also interfere with the remote control signal of the Civic. It is also possible to be closer to the car to use the key fob.

Also, make sure you examine your fob for hidden keys. If you have one, you might be capable of unlocking your car by pressing the "LOCKbutton for one second. If you do not have one, check your phone to see if you have saved the fob's code.

How can I get a Honda civic key duplicate with a spare

It's not easy to duplicate the Honda Civic key and get an additional key. There are numerous factors to take into consideration. The type of key, year of the car and its model are significant.

Honda keys are highly technologically advanced devices. They communicate with the immobilizer's chip, as well as the onboard computer. This makes it very difficult to take the car.

You can either get a new key cut at the dealership or a locksmith if you need it. Some locksmiths offer mobile services. They might charge less than the dealership but they'll have to travel to your location.

To replace your Honda key, you'll require the VIN. The VIN number is located on the left side, close to the mirror. The VIN allows dealers to determine the car's information.

The locksmith or the dealership will program the key. A special machine will read the key code and match the new key to the vehicle. It takes just some minutes to program your key.

In the event of an emergency, purchase a spare car key for your car. It is a key that can be used on all doors and trunks. It should also be like your house key. It should operate smoothly.

If you've lost your key and you've lost your key, you could be covered under your auto insurance policy. Certain insurance companies will cover the cost of towing the vehicle to the dealer. It may also cover cost of replacing the key.

Remote keys can be used to open and lock doors when you have masterkeys that work remotely. It can also turn on or off the car when it is within range.
